For the 2026 school year, there are 4 public middle schools serving 696 students in Alger County, MI.
The top-ranked public middle schools in Alger County, MI are Superior Central School, Autrainonota Public School and Burt Township School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Alger County, MI public middle schools have an average math proficiency score of 29% (versus the Michigan public middle school average of 31%), and reading proficiency score of 43% (versus the 44% statewide average). Middle schools in Alger County have an average ranking of 5/10, which is in the bottom 50% of Michigan public middle schools.
Minority enrollment is 17% of the student body (majority American Indian), which is less than the Michigan public middle school average of 42% (majority Black).
